The O1 visa is a non-immigrant visa category designed for individuals with extraordinary abilities in sciences, arts, education, business, or athletics. It allows qualified professionals to work in the United States temporarily. However, meeting the O1 visa requirements can be complex, as applicants must demonstrate a high level of achievement in their respective fields. Understanding the eligibility criteria and preparing a strong application can significantly improve the chances of approval.

Preparing A Strong O1 Visa Application

Meeting the O1 visa requirements requires extensive documentation and strategic presentation. The application process involves the following key steps:

Applicants cannot self-petition for an O1 visa. They must have a U.S.-based employer, agent, or sponsor who will submit the petition on their behalf. This sponsor will file Form I-129, Petition for a Nonimmigrant Worker, with the USCIS, along with supporting evidence demonstrating the applicant’s qualifications.

Gathering Strong Evidence Of Extraordinary Ability

To strengthen the application, individuals must present substantial evidence that meets the O1 visa requirements. Supporting documents may include:

  • Certificates and awards recognizing achievements
  • Letters of recommendation from industry experts
  • Media coverage or publications about the applicant
  • Contracts or agreements that highlight the applicant’s significant role in projects
  • Proof of high earnings compared to others in the same industry

Obtaining An Advisory Opinion

Applicants in the arts and entertainment fields must submit an advisory opinion from a peer group, labor organization, or relevant industry body. This letter serves as an endorsement of the applicant’s exceptional ability and contributions to the field.

Filing Form I-129 And Supporting Documents

The sponsor must submit Form I-129 at least 45 days before the intended start date of employment. Along with the form, the petition must include:

  • Detailed employment contracts or agreements
  • A written itinerary outlining the applicant’s work schedule
  • Evidence demonstrating the applicant meets at least three O1 visa criteria

Attending A Visa Interview

If the petition is approved, the applicant must schedule a visa interview at a U.S. embassy or consulate in their home country. During the interview, the applicant will answer questions about their background, achievements, and employment in the U.S. Providing clear and compelling responses can help secure visa approval.

Common Challenges In Meeting O1 Visa Requirements

Applying for an O1 visa can be challenging due to the stringent criteria. Some of the most common obstacles applicants face include:

  • Lack of Sufficient Documentation – Meeting the minimum requirement of three criteria is not enough; strong evidence must be provided.
  • Insufficient Letters of Recommendation – The USCIS highly values expert opinions, so letters from established industry leaders must be well-written and detailed.
  • Weak Employment Evidence – If an applicant does not have a clear contract or defined work itinerary, their application may face delays or denials.
  • Misunderstanding the Extraordinary Ability Requirement – Many applicants underestimate the level of recognition needed. National or international acclaim is required, not just excellence in the field.

Improving Your Chances Of O1 Visa Approval

To increase the likelihood of approval, applicants should:

  • Start gathering evidence early and maintain an extensive record of achievements
  • Seek guidance from an immigration attorney with experience in O1 visa cases
  • Obtain well-drafted letters of recommendation from highly reputable individuals
  • Clearly outline professional contributions and their impact on the field
  • Ensure all documents are organized, concise, and professionally presented
